Located in the Lake Fenton Community Schools at 4070 Lahring Road in Linden, MI, Lake Fenton High School serves grades 9-12 and has an enrollment of roughly 628 students. Frequently Asked Questions about Linden
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Linden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Linden ranges from $740 to $1,899 with an average monthly rent of $1,027.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Linden c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Linden range from $650 to $2,999.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,288.
How expensive are Linden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 16 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Linden on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,417 to $2,599 - averaging $1,751 for the location.
